Management noted that the operating environment continued to shift, with a greater emphasis on value-oriented advisory services. Executives pointed to the firm’s ongoing investments in technology and data analytics as key drivers that helped improve efficiency and support adviser productivity. The company’s strategic focus on organic growth initiatives, including expanding its network of affiliated advisers and enhancing platform capabilities, was underscored as a foundation for future momentum. Management also discussed the potential headwinds from market volatility and interest rate adjustments, but expressed confidence in the firm’s diversified business model. Operational highlights included a continued commitment to cost control and the deployment of capital toward share repurchases, which management indicated could support per-share earnings over time. While specific revenue figures were not disclosed, the commentary suggested that the earnings beat was supported by a favorable mix of assets under management and stable fee-based income. Overall, the tone remained measured, with management emphasizing the importance of executing on long-term strategic priorities amid a dynamic economic landscape.

Forward Guidance
Looking ahead, management noted on the recent earnings call that the company anticipates moderate organic revenue growth in the upcoming quarters, supported by continued strength in its core asset management segments. While specific quantitative guidance was not provided, executives expressed confidence in the firm’s ability to generate stable fee income amid evolving market conditions. The firm expects to maintain disciplined expense management, which could support margins even if revenue growth decelerates. Additionally, the company highlighted potential opportunities from recent product launches and distribution expansions, though the timing of contributions remains uncertain. Capital allocation priorities are expected to remain balanced between organic investments and shareholder returns, with dividends likely sustained at current levels. Management also acknowledged macroeconomic headwinds that may pressure near-term flows, but overall the tone suggested cautious optimism. Forward-looking commentary emphasized operational resilience rather than aggressive growth targets.

The stock experienced heightened volatility in the immediate trading session following the announcement, with shares initially moving higher on the headline EPS beat against consensus estimates. However, the absence of top-line data injected a note of caution, leading to a partial pullback from session highs.
Analysts covering AMG have expressed mixed views in the wake of the results. Some note the EPS strength could reflect effective cost management or favorable asset under management flows during the quarter, while others highlight the lack of revenue disclosure as a potential red flag, suggesting that investors may be pricing in increased uncertainty about the sustainability of margins. The stock's trading volume was notably elevated compared to recent averages, indicating active repositioning by institutional investors.
From a price-action perspective, AMG shares have since settled into a range, with technical measures such as the relative strength index hovering near neutral territory. The market appears to be weighing the positive earnings surprise against the opacity of the top-line performance. As a result, near-term price direction may likely depend on further clarification from management or upcoming sector trends rather than a single-quarter outlier.
